Q: How do allergies directly affect the eyes?
A: Chronic allergies may lead to permanent damage to the tissue of your eye and eyelids. If left untreated, it may even cause scarring of the conjunctiva, the membrane covering the inner eyelid that extends to the whites of the eyes. Ocular allergies can make contact lens wear almost impossible and are among the many causes of contact lens drop-out. Most common allergy medications will tend to dry out the eyes, and relying on nasal sprays containing corticosteroids can increase the pressure inside your eyes, causing other complications such as glaucoma.
Q: I've heard that blue light is dangerous, like UV radiation. Do I need to protect my eyes from it and, if so, how?
A: We all know about ultraviolet (UV) sun damage, but recently, the optical community has found that high-energy visible light (HEV) or "blue light" from digital screens may cause long term damage to the eye, too. Over time, exposure can increase the risk of macular degeneration, and other problems. Similar to anti-reflective and UV-protective coatings, a new lens coating has been developed to protect our eyes by blocking out blue light rays coming from our handheld devices, computers and fluorescent bulbs.
Q: Why is my child having trouble reading and concentrating on schoolwork?
A: Your child may have an underlying refractive issue, such as farsightedness, nearsightedness or an astigmatism that maybe be causing blurred vision, making it hard for your child to concentrate and focus. There may also binocularity issues, which is how well the two eyes work together, or focusing issues that can affect a child's schoolwork. When working with your child, we will evaluate the visual system including binocular and accommodative systems to determine if his/her vision may be interfering with academic success.
